Was it camera angle that made it appear to be so perfectly flat (top and bottom of rocket at same altitude) when it was in free fall or was that actually the target free fall orientation?

Yeah, it does a "belly flop" during descent, presenting as much area as possible to the airflow, reducing its terminal velocity.

For both SN8 and SN9 my brain is screaming at me "surely they need more than 3 engines?!" Is the ultimate expectation that the engines will never fail, because it sure seems like they can't deal with losing even a single engine. I'm sure this is completely incorrect given that the issue for SN8 was tank pressure.

The issue is that the Raptor engines can only throttle down to 40% which represents a large thrust-to-weight ratio when you have basically just an empty tank.

There is also a startup time for each engine, so if one fails Starship will likely hit the ground before they can light another.

There are enough engines that a failure on ascent can be handled gracefully but landing is another story.

Love seeing these tests for two reasons: 1.) Experiencing history in the making, especially knowing that the SpaceX team will eventually get it right. 2.) Realizing that even the best of the best have repeated failures and need to rely on iteration to get "there."

On the 'repeated failures' piece, that's somewhat new for aerospace. Traditionally, things would be over-engineered, and losing a test vessel would be considered a bad thing. SpaceX seems very content to blow up a bunch of rockets on their way towards not blowing up rockets. This seems to have caused at least part of their recent issues with the FAA, who seem to be less ok with explosions. It will be very interesting…

The early days of the Soviet space program were similar - fast construction and iterative improvements with each successive test.

Honestly, my main takeaway from this testing and Falcon 9 dev has been that we should be doing a whole lot more of that than we have been, at least until there are human passengers. The contrast in rate of progress with eg SLS is stunning.

The way to make them more reliable is not to put human passengers while increasing the iteration rate and manufacturing speed.

The two ways I heard to get really reliable products is to get good at manufacturing them reliably at scale or be really slow and really careful in making them one at a time.
